School Description
Rolling Acres School enrolls 22 elementary school students from grades 1-8. It is located in Lykens, PA, which is a medium sized city with a median household income of $33,846.
School Days and Hours
- School Days Per Year: 180
- School Hours Per Day: 7
School Religious Orientation
- Amish
